返回
python中random.randint的计算方式
random.randint(a, b)是 Python 标准库random中的一个函数,用于生成一个指定范围内的随机整数。这个函数的计算方式是:1.参数定义:o a:表示生成随机数的下限(包含)。o b:表示生成随机数的上限(包含)。2.计算过程:random.randint(a, b)内部实现机制会确保生成的随机数在[a, b]范围内,即生成的随机数至少是a,并且至多是b。它通过内部算法(通常...
Python内置random模块生成随机数的方法
Python内置random模块⽣成随机数的⽅法本⽂我们详细地介绍下两个模块关于⽣成随机序列的其他使⽤⽅法。随机数参与的应⽤场景⼤家⼀定不会陌⽣,⽐如密码加盐时会在原密码上关联⼀串随机数,蒙特卡洛算法会通过随机数采样等等。Python内置的random模块提供了⽣成随机数的⽅法,使⽤这些⽅法时需要导⼊random模块。import random下⾯介绍下Python内置的random模块的⼏种⽣成...
python生成随机小数列表_python如何生成随机小数
python⽣成随机⼩数列表_python如何⽣成随机⼩数python中的random模块⽤于随机数(1)随机⼩数#(1)随机⼩数import randomprint(random.random()) #随机⼤于0 且⼩于1 之间的⼩数'''0.9441832228391154'''print(random.uniform(0,9)) #随机⼀个⼤于0⼩于9的⼩数'''结果:7.646583891...
python生成1到100的列表_python列表生成式与列表生成器的使用
python⽣成1到100的列表_python列表⽣成式与列表⽣成器的使⽤列表⽣成式:会将所有的结果全部计算出来,把结果存放到内存中,如果列表中数据⽐较多,就会占⽤过多的内存空间,可能会导致MemoryError内存错误或者导致程序在运⾏时出现卡顿的情况列表⽣成器:会创建⼀个列表⽣成器对象,不会⼀次性的把所有结果都计算出来,如果需要获取数据,可以使⽤next()函数来获取,但是需要注意,⼀旦nex...
python标准库random的方法(一)
python标准库random的方法(一)Python标准库random详解介绍Python标准库中的random模块提供了许多用于生成随机数的方法。无论是需要生成随机数还是进行随机选择,random模块都可以满足你的需求。基础随机数生成方法•():该方法返回0到1之间的随机浮点数。•(a, b):该方法返回a到b之间的随机整数,包括a和b。•(a, b):该方法返回a到b之间的随机浮点数。与()...
【python】np.random.uniform生成随机数、np.ones和np.empty
【python】np.random.uniform⽣成随机数、np.ones和np.emptypython生成1到100之间随机数1、⽤法:numpy.random.uniform(low,high,size)返回:随机⽣成指定范围的浮点数,从⼀个均匀分布[low,high)中随机采样,定义域是左闭右开,包含low,不包含high,ndarray类型,其形状与size中描述⼀致.参数介绍:low:...
python随机生成数字与输入数字比较_生成随机数,怎么留下一些比较顺的...
python随机⽣成数字与输⼊数字⽐较_⽣成随机数,怎么留下⼀些⽐较顺的数字。...参考楼上各位回答,需要明确的是以下两个问题1. 对于好号码的定义,就像AntonyBi所讲『什么样的号码才是好的号码』2. 如何筛选(⽣成好号码)对于问题⼀。我认为可以直接参考已有的规则(规则针对的是⼿机号的尾号),毕竟号码的好坏是⼈的感受。另外规则不⽤定太多,链接中的有九条规则,保证了通常来讲最『顺』的号码另作分...
python实现安全随机数_使用Python生成用于管理机密的安全随机数
python实现安全随机数_使⽤Python⽣成⽤于管理机密的安全随机数为了通过密码⽣成安全的随机数,我们可以在python中使⽤secrets模块。此模块有助于创建安全密码,帐户⾝份验证,安全令牌或某些相关机密。要使⽤secrets模块的类和模块,我们应该将该模块导⼊我们的代码中。import secrets随机数该秘密模块⽤于随机访问⼀些安全的来源。这是由操作系统提供的。与秘密模块的随机数有关...
Python随机数生成不重复
Python随机数⽣成不重复sample()⽅法返回⼀个列表,其中包含从序列中随机选择的指定数量的项⽬。random.sample(sequence, k)random.sample(range(1,N), k)表⽰从[1,N]的范围内随机⽣成k个数,结果返回列表如:随机⽣成5个(1, 15)范围内的数字:import random #随机数for i in range(5):ran...
python中random函数的用法
python中random函数的用法在Python中,random模块是一个用于生成伪随机数的标准库。它提供了多个函数,用于生成不同种类的随机数,可以应用于许多不同的场景中。下面将详细介绍random模块中常用的函数及其用法。1. random.randomrandom(函数返回一个0到1之间的随机浮点数。该函数没有任何参数,每次调用时都会返回一个新的随机数。示例代码:```pythonimpor...
python随机生成数字列表_Python生成一组随机数列表
python随机⽣成数字列表_Python⽣成⼀组随机数列表⼀. 最直接的⽅式:⽤numpy.random模块来⽣成随机数组1、np.random.rand ⽤于⽣成[0.0, 1.0)之间的随机浮点数, 当没有参数时,返回⼀个随机浮点数,当有⼀个参数时,返回该参数长度⼤⼩的⼀维随机浮点数数组,参数建议是整数型,因为未来版本的numpy可能不⽀持⾮整形参数。import numpy as np&g...
12种最常用PHP字符串函数总结分析
1、查字符位置函数:strpos($str,search,[int]):查search在$str中的次位置从int始;stripos($str,search,[int]):函数返回字符串在另一个字符串中次出现的位置。该函数对小写不敏感strrpos($str,search,[int]):查search在$str中的最后一次出现的位置从int始;strripos($str,search,[in...
php常用的包含文件的操作函数
php常用的包含文件的操作函数在PHP中,有许多方式用于包含文件。以下是常用的一些包含文件的操作函数:1. include(: 用于包含文件,如果包含失败,会产生一个警告,并且脚本会继续执行。例如:```phpinclude 'header.php';```2. require(: 用于包含文件,如果包含失败,会产生一个致命错误,并且脚本会停止执行。例如:```phprequire 'config...
php显示时间常用方法
php显示时间常用方法php延时函数php显示时间常用方法php显示时间常用方法,实例总结了php时间显示的常用技巧,包括获取当前时间、设置时区时间、计算时间差等,需要的朋友可以参考下.本文实例讲述了php显示时间常用方法。分享给大家供大家参考。具体分析如下:一、PHP函数Date()获取当前时间代码:复制代码 代码如下:<?php echo $showtime=date("Y-m-d H:...
php对一个变量向上取整,PHP向上取整函数ceil
php对⼀个变量向上取整,PHP向上取整函数ceilPHP取整函数有ceil,floor,round,intval,下⾯详细介绍⼀下:1、ceil — 进⼀法取整 说明 float ceil ( float $value ) 返回不⼩于 value 的下⼀个整数,value 如果有⼩数部分则进⼀位。ceil() 返回的类型仍然是 float,因为 float 值的范围通常⽐ integer 要⼤。...
php显示时间的常用方法
php显示时间的常用方法php显示时间的常用方法php显示时间常用方法,实例总结了php时间显示的常用技巧,包括获取当前时间、设置时区时间、计算时间差等。我们为大家收集整理了关于php显示时间,以方便大家参考。一、PHP函数Date()获取当前时间代码如下:php延时函数显示的格式: 年-月-日 小时:分钟:秒相关参数:a:"am"或者"pm"A:"AM"或者"PM"d:几日,二位数字,若不足二位...
php原生代码实现explode函数功能
php原⽣代码实现explode函数功能 在开始代码前要先介绍⼏个PHP函数:explode() 把字符串打散成数组strpos() 返回字符串在另⼀个字符串第⼀次出现的位置(对⼤⼩写敏感)strstr() 查字符串在另⼀个字符串的位置,并返回剩余部分(对⼤⼩写敏感)substr() ...
PHP获取毫秒和微秒
PHP获取毫秒和微秒PHP获取毫秒和微秒这⼏个概念的换算关系是:1秒(second) = 1000毫秒(millisecond) = 1000,000微秒(microsecond)PHP的函数可以获取到微秒和毫秒数,但是和time() 函数不同,获取到的不是int类型,⽽是字符串,也可以设置get_as_float 参数为true 返回浮点数(单位为秒)返回字符串官⽅⽂档给的例⼦:<?php...
在PHP中使用UUID扩展的函数
在PHP中使⽤UUID扩展的函数环境:CentOS Linux release 7.7.1908 (Core)PHP 7.3.11UUID Extention 1.0.4感觉上PHP对UUID的⽀持似乎不是很上⼼,PECL中的UUID扩展仅仅是对libuuid的打包,并没有像其他语⾔那样直接提供完整的UUID实现。由于libuuid仅仅提供了版本1和版本4的UUID,所以……,开⼼⼀点,这两个就够...
php数学常用函数
php数学常用函数php数学常用函数PHP语法吸收了C语言、Java和Perl的特点,利于学习,使用广泛,主要适用于Web开发领域。下面是店铺精心为大家整理的php数学常用的函数,希望对大家有帮助,更多内容请关注应届毕业生网!定义和用法:abs() 函数返回一个数的绝对值.语法:abs(x),代码如下:$abs=abs(-3.2); //$abs=3.2$abs2=abs(5); //$abs2=...
利用PHP与MediaWikiAPI来获取信息
利用PHP 与MediaWiki API 来获取信息简介常用缩略语∙API:应用程序编程接口∙CSRF:跨站点请求伪造∙HTML:超文本标记语言∙HTTP:超文本传输协议∙IP:因特网协议∙JSON:JavaScript 对象标记法∙OOP:面向对象编程∙PEAR:PHP 扩展与应用程序库∙REST:具象状态传输∙WDDX:Web 分布式数据交换∙XHTML:可扩展超文本标记语言∙XML:...
php-Api接口写法规范和要求
php-Api接⼝写法规范和要求前⾔说明是⼀个API⽂档⽣成⼯具, apidoc可以根据代码注释⽣成web api⽂档, apidoc从注释⽣成静态html⽹页⽂档,不仅⽀持项⽬版本号,还⽀持api版本号安装A). 系统需要安装nodejs(略)B). 安装apidoc# 有些系统需要sudo 权限来安装$ npm install apidoc -g复制代码C). 执⾏⽣成# 这个⽂档的⽣成规则是...
关于@JsonFormat(出参格式化)和@DateTimeFormat(入参格式化)时间戳转换...
关于@JsonFormat(出参格式化)和@DateTimeFormat(⼊参格式化)时间戳转换背景: 从数据库查询获取数据时候返回的json数据⽇期会出现⼀串数字或者其他形式和我们期待的不⼀样 如下图:⼀开始使⽤@DateTimeFormat注解但是输出结果和没有使⽤返回的json相同,后来了解到这个注解是在前台到后台时间格式转换然后@JsonFormat注解后台到前台时...
一个php数组转json变对象的踩坑记录
⼀个php数组转json变对象的踩坑记录这⾥是⼯作中遇到的另⼀个⼩坑,虽然说起来很简单,但是如果不注意还是会中招。这⾥记录下来防⽌以后再犯这种错误。问题描述这是在⼯作中出现的⼀个问题,前端报接⼝返回值跟接⼝⽂档不⼀致。⽂档约定是返回数组,但是实际返回的是⼀个对象。对象但是我在本地和⽤另⼀个测试账户调⽤都是返回数组,只有这个账户返回对象。phpjson格式化输出数组解决过程于是跟着代码⼀步步跟下去,...
springmvc学习笔记-返回json的日期格式问题的解决方法
springmvc学习笔记-返回json的⽇期格式问题的解决⽅法springmvc学习笔记--json--返回json的⽇期格式问题(⼀)输出json数据springmvc中使⽤jackson-mapper-asl即可进⾏json输出,在配置上有⼏点:1.使⽤mvc:annotation-driven2.在依赖管理中添加jackson-mapper-asl<dependency><...
JSON时间转换格式化
JSON时间转换格式化通常JSON时间⼀般是这样的格式。1/Date(1436595149269)/通常我们⽤AJAX获取下来的JSON数据,如果有时间,都是这种格式的。其中,中间的⼀段数字"1436595149269"表⽰的是1970年1⽉1⽇⾄今的毫秒数。这种时间格式并不能够直接显⽰给⽤户查看,因为这是⼈类所看不懂的时间。所以我们需要将它转换为正常⼈能够理解的时间格式。第⼀步,替换掉/Date...
php用json_decode将json转换为数组
php⽤json_decode将json转换为数组语法mixed json_decode ($json_string [,$assoc = false [, $depth = 512 [, $options = 0 ]]])json_string: 待解码的 JSON 字符串,必须是 UTF-8 编码数据assoc: 当该参数为 TRUE 时,将返回数组,FALSE 时返回对象。需要转换为数组时必...
yii2使用ajax返回json的实现方法
yii2使用ajax返回json的实现方法Yii2 是一款快速、安全、专业的 PHP 框架,它提供了丰富的功能和工具,方便我们开发高效的 Web 应用程序。在 Yii2 中,我们可以使用 AJAX 技术实现动态加载数据,并返回 JSON 格式的数据给前端。以下是一种使用 Yii2 实现 AJAX 返回 JSON 的方法:1. 添加 jQuery 库首先,需要在我们的页面中添加 jQuery 库,Y...
curl发送json格式数据
curl发送json格式数据 php的curl⽅法详细的见官⽅⼿册。<?php$params = array('par1' => 'a','par2' => 11,);$header = array("Content-type: application/json");// 注意header头,格式k:v$arrParams = json_encode($params)...
thinkphp6:自定义异常处理使统一返回json数据(thinkphp6.
thinkphp6:⾃定义异常处理使统⼀返回json数据(thinkphp6.0.5php。。。⼀,创建统⼀返回json格式数据的result类app/business/Result/Result.php<?phpnamespace app\business\Result;class Result {//successstatic public function Success($data)...